Institute Index: Taxing Times

Latest stats from our Facing South newsletter (you can sign up using the box to the right):

Percent of citizens making less than $25,000 a year audited by the IRS in 2005: 8.8%

Percent making more than $200,000 a year that were audited: 4.6%

Percent of millionaires audited: .02%

Value of tax refund claimed this year by Vice President Dick Cheney and his wife: $1.9 million

Percent of a $165 million contribution made by Texas billionaire T. Boone Pickens that he wrote off his taxes under a special tax provision to help Hurricane Katrina victims: 100%

Percent of his contribution that went to the golfing program at Oklahoma State University: 100%

Estimated amount that President Bush's tax cuts will increase the national debt over next 10 years: $900 billion

Percent of U.S. residents who believe we should keep the estate tax, which Congress will consider eliminating in May: 57%
